As we passed by the bridge that was at the border to our town, Irewamiri said, “Wow, the water level has risen”. I responded that “It is because it has been raining”.

When it rains, the rivers overflow.

Naturally, the rain makes a lot of difference. The rain impacts the soil and causes dry land to become fertile ground. The rain touches the rivers and causes them to overflow. The rain brings some coolness by reducing the heat of the day. The rain is the joy of farmers.

Jesus said to us that there is a river of living water in the belly of every believer. The river of living water is a reference to the Holy Spirit.

He who believes in Me [who adheres to, trusts in, and relies on Me], as the Scripture has said, ‘From his innermost being will flow continually rivers of living water.’ ”
John 7:38 AMP

The rivers of your belly will not flow when there is no connection to the rain of the presence of the Lord.

For as the rain and snow come down from heaven, And do not return there without watering the earth, Making it bear and sprout, And providing seed to the sower and bread to the eater, So will My word be which goes out of My mouth; It will not return to Me void (useless, without result), Without accomplishing what I desire, And without succeeding in the matter for which I sent it.
Isaiah 55:10‭-‬11 AMP

When there is intercourse between the Word and the Spirit, it leads to remarkable changes. It results in an overflow. It was the effective team that facilitated creation.

Once the Rain of the Word falls on our ground, it leads to an overflow in our spirit that results in thanksgiving.

Let the word of Christ live in you richly, flooding you with all wisdom. Apply the Scriptures as you teach and instruct one another with the Psalms, and with festive praises, and with prophetic songs given to you spontaneously by the Spirit, so sing to God with all your hearts!
Colossians 3:16 TPT

A man in the overflow season is a man full of joy and thanksgiving to the Lord. Such a man is unstoppable. Such a man becomes a force.
